How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Franklin?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Franklin Studio Apartments | $932 | $425 | $1,194 |
| Franklin 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,177 | $595 | $1,595 |
| Franklin 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,361 | $625 | $1,759 |
| Franklin 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,493 | $1,145 | $1,804 |
| Franklin 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,115 | $1,100 | $1,350 |
